Teen Mental Health and the Importance of Positive Peer Influences

By March 15, 2024Mental Health

During adolescence, peer relationships play a crucial role in shaping teens’ identities, behaviors, and overall mental health. Positive peer influences can have a profound impact on teens, providing them with support, encouragement, and a sense of belonging. This article explores the importance of positive peer influences on teen mental health and offers strategies for fostering positive peer relationships.

The Impact of Peer Relationships on Teen Mental Health

Peer relationships can significantly impact teen mental health. Positive peer influences can provide emotional support, boost self-esteem, and promote healthy behaviors. On the other hand, negative peer influences, such as peer pressure or bullying, can contribute to feelings of isolation, low self-worth, and mental health issues.

Benefits of Positive Peer Influences

Positive peer influences can have several benefits for teen mental health, including:

  • Emotional Support: Positive peer relationships can provide teens with a sense of belonging and acceptance, which can help reduce feelings of loneliness and isolation.
  • Increased Self-Esteem: Positive peer influences can boost teens’ self-esteem and confidence, helping them develop a positive self-image.
  • Healthy Behaviors: Positive peer influences can encourage teens to engage in healthy behaviors, such as exercise, good nutrition, and avoiding risky behaviors.
  • Improved Coping Skills: Positive peer relationships can help teens develop effective coping skills, enabling them to better manage stress and adversity.

Strategies for Fostering Positive Peer Relationships

There are several strategies parents, educators, and caregivers can use to foster positive peer relationships among teens:

  1. Encourage Open Communication: Encouraging teens to communicate openly with their peers can help strengthen their relationships and build trust.
  2. Promote Empathy and Understanding: Teaching teens to empathize with others and understand different perspectives can help promote positive interactions.
  3. Provide Opportunities for Socialization: Providing opportunities for teens to socialize in safe and supervised environments can help them develop positive peer relationships.
  4. Model Positive Behavior: Adults can model positive behavior and encourage teens to surround themselves with peers who exhibit similar traits.
